I get the privilege of creating and sharing a project featuring the "Bee Happy" stamp set for the hop. So here is what I came up with!




I have been on treat project kick a bit. They are fun and Miss Emma's dies make them so easy to create.

So I took the MCT: Lollipop Holder Die and used a little bag of "Bit O' Honey" instead of a lollipop. 

I then put the beautiful flower on top from MCT: Stitched Daisy. I inked the edges with Colorbox light blue ink and added clear glitter to the center.

I added two leaves to the daisy from MCT: Stitched Leaves. I inked the edges with green Colorbox ink.



I stamped on the bee trail from MCT: Live, Love, Laugh and Be Happy.

I stamped on the sentiment from the new "Bee Happy" onto the MCT: Stitched Oval Die.

I cut out the bee shadow and then stamped him on also from "Bee Happy" and "Stitched Bees & Bee Hives".  I then colored him in with Copic Markers.

I finished by adding twine around the top of the bag and a little honey comb from the new "Stitched Honey Comb" die.

I was inspired by a photograph I saw on Pinterest . It is an amazing shot and gave me the idea to create a light house card.  Which is a great project to make since Miss  Emma  has the perfect stamp set to go with it.  


I found a free light house cut file from SVG Cutting Files. I first created the card base by adhering two shadows of the light house together. I used a white gel pen to add stitching on the outside of the base.

I then cut out all the pieces of the light house using Recollection's card stock. Once I got it put together, I took my white gel pen and added a few accents to each piece.


I stamped on the sentiment from My Creative Time's Lost at Sea Stamp Set with Memento Tuxedo Black Ink.

I then added gray twine from my stash around the light house. Then I added a small heart from My Creative Time's Stitched Heart Layering.

I finished the card by adding glossy accents to the water and then putting clear glitter on top to make it sparkle.

I created this for my oldest son's teacher as a thank you gift! She has been an amazing teacher and I wanted to show my appreciation. 



I first started out with a 12" ring I purchased at Michael's and added some measuring tap ribbon. Then I hot glued the crayons all over the wreath. I used four boxes of Crayola's 24 count boxes. Before hand, I separated them into the colors of the rainbow.

It was so nice to dust off my Cricut since I haven't used it in a bit. All the cuts were Cricut except the chalk board. It comes from Pretty Paper Pretty Ribbons. The bus, ABC's/123's, apple, glue, scissors, school house, books, bus, and crayon all came from the Cricut Recess cart. The paper is from Locker Talk. The teacher's name comes from Paper Lace.

On the glue bottle I used PKS: Lucy's ABC's and 123's Outlines. I used PKS: Retro-Bet Round on the books and the bus.



The cute little worm as well as the "grade sentiment" comes from PKSC-8 August 2012 SOTM kit. The worm's face is from the new PKS: Clowning Around Face Assortment. I know it is meant for clowns but I thought it made an adorable worm face.



I used PKS: The Moodies from the first little girl on the bus. I used PKS: Sweet and Innocent for the boy in red. I used PKS: Simple Simons for the boy in the orange. For the last girl, I used PKS: Princess face assortment.  I just love having my peachy faces on hand to use especially when there are little cuts involved. My Peachies made it so easy to stamp on the faces, instead of trying to cut out teeny tiny pieces. 

Once I had all my pieces put together how I wanted, I glued them onto the wreath.
